java实现数据库备份

 时间:2026-02-13 10:46:11

1、第一步,准备好MySQL数据库,eclipse工具,把下面的代码复制一个java项目的普通java文件里就可以测试了。

public static void main(String[] args) {

// 数据库导出

String user = "root"; // 数据库帐号

String password = "root"; // 数据库密码

String database = "condiment"; // 需要备份的数据库名

String filepath = "D:\\mysql.sql"; // 需要备份到的地址

String stmt1 = "mysqldump " + database + " -u " + user + " -p" + password + " --result-file=" + filepath;

try {

     Runtime.getRuntime().exec(stmt1);

     System.out.println("数据已导出到文件" + filepath + "中");

} catch (IOException e) {

     e.printStackTrace();

}

}

java实现数据库备份

2、第二步,代码拷贝到eclipse后,运行这个main方法,如果控制台出现“数据已导出到文件D:\mysql.sql中”就表示数据库拷贝成功。如下图。

java实现数据库备份

3、第三步,此时在D盘就可以看到我们从数据库备份出来的SQL文件,需要用的时候只要把该SQL文件导入数据库即可。如果不成功请注意检查,是否在系统变量path配置了mysql环境,即是把mysql的bin目录加到系统变量path中。

java实现数据库备份

4、说明:每次备份系统会自动覆盖原来的SQL文件,也就是说在D盘中的文件是最近一次备份的。(可以文件的生成时间了解备份动态)。

  • Visual Studio 2015如何输入注册码
  • Notepad++怎么子菜单中显示完整路径
  • 如何用汇编在命令提示符中显示5大于3?
  • 教你怎么用python获得本机的IP地址
  • 工作表中如何提取字符串中的奇数部分?
  • 热门搜索
    现在去哪里旅游最好 长白山冬季旅游攻略 德夯苗寨旅游攻略 适合老年人旅游的地方 安徽九华山旅游攻略 烟台旅游政务网官网 冬季北京旅游攻略 从化有什么旅游景点 布里斯班旅游 这个季节去哪里旅游最好